Council seals roundabout deal with Lyreco

A distributor of office supplies and workplace products is the latest business to add its name to one of Telford and Wrekin’s roundabouts and Welcome To Telford signs as part of the council’s sponsorship scheme.

Lyreco’s name has been put on the signs placed on the Hollinsgate roundabout and added to the Welcome To Telford signs for a minimum of 12 months.

Telford & Wrekin Council offers local business the opportunity to advertise on a range of outdoor and digital advertising platforms. On roundabouts, they can have their name, logo and a brief message put on to signs that are then put on their chosen roundabout.


Sponsorship signs are seen by the thousands of people who travel on the borough’s roads everyday, including the 3.5m tourists who visit the town’s attractions every year.


The signs can be close to the sponsoring business’s premises or on a roundabout that has a large traffic volume circulating around it for maximum brand exposure. The money generated from the sponsorship scheme helps to fund vital front line council services.


In a survey of 1,000 local residents, 84 per cent of people recalled seeing a sponsorship sign on a Telford roundabout and market research shows that 85 per cent of existing sponsors would recommend the opportunity to a colleague or business associate.
